The azygos anterior cerebral artery is a rare variant, characterized by the absence of the anterior communicating artery and the union of two proximal segments of the anterior cerebral artery, forming a single trunk and ascending through the interhemispheric fissure. The incidence in the population varies from 0.3 to 2%. The presence of occlusion for this vessel causes bifrontal infarcts, with potentially devastating functional consequences, hence the importance of recognizing this anatomical variation ...

Pure blowout fracture is an injury in which only one internal orbit wall is affected, without any compromise of the orbital rim or another region. The inferior and the medial walls are the most frequently affected areas. The patient usually presents diplopia, infraorbital nerve paresthesia and entrapment of soft tissue within the maxillary sinus, which leads to a possible limitation of the ocular movements and enophthalmos. Computer tomography scan is a helpful method for the diagnosis and qualification ...

The Rio Grande do Norte coast extends 410 km, and consists of sandy beaches (72 %), active sea cliffs carved into Cenozoic sediments of the Barreiras and Tibau formations (26 %), and transgressive dune fields and beachrock. It comprises two different sectors: the northern (equatorial) coast trends east for 244 km, while the eastern (oriental) coast trends south for 166 km. The eastern sector is characterized by wave-dominated and some tide-modified beaches that are mainly reflective to intermediate states. ...
